Description:
This special workshop is designed for members of Google's PiShop seeking safety training on basic woodshop power tools. We'll cover the general safety and operating principles of many of the tools available to you at PiShop, including the Jointer, Planer, Table Saw, Sliding Compound Miter Saw, Handheld Routers, and Manual Router Table. We'll show you everything you need to turn a rough piece of wood into a squared board, and shape it using both handheld and table routers.
